We are seeking a reliable Environmental Services Assistant that is responsible for providing day-to-day support services to the residents and staff in the functions of housekeeping and laundry.
Responsibilities:
- Cleans and sanitizes interior of buildings to meet sanitary and quality regulations.
- Washes windows, walls, sinks, tubs, mirrors, etc.
- Ensures soap, towels, and similar supplies are adequately stocked.
- Performs routine weekly cleaning activities, such as dusting, mopping, etc.
- Performs trash removal and transports to disposal area.
- Performs laundry duties.
- Provides light maintenance duties, such as painting.
- Performs floor maintenance to include buffing and waxing.
- Cleans wheelchairs and other consumer apparatus and equipment.
- Assists in organizing and maintaining storage areas; stocks environmental and nursing supplies and materials; notifies supervisor of low levels.
- Sets up chairs and tables for meetings and special occasions.
- Shovels snow in winter months.
- Reports to supervisor any mechanical failures or hazardous conditions.
- Carries out the mission of the organization and is a role model operating with the highest standards of ethical practices.
- Maintains a clean work environment; follows safety & emergency procedures as well as reporting of safety and health concerns in a timely manner.
- Assist with residents moving and/or other moves/changes as needed.
- Assures the confidentiality of all data, including resident, employee and operations data in compliance with HIPAA policy & confidentiality procedures.
- Attends meetings as required.
- Performs other duties as assigned.
